Is Hay a Crop? Explaining Its Place in Agriculture

Hay is a processed product derived from plants that can also be grazed by livestock, which often creates confusion about its classification as an agricultural crop. Unlike grains or vegetables, hay is not a species itself but a preserved form of various cultivated forage plants. This preservation step is a deliberate, managed process that transforms field-grown material into a storable commodity.

Hay: Definition and Classification as a Crop

Hay is defined as grasses, legumes, or other herbaceous plants that are purposefully cut, dried, and stored for use as animal fodder. The material is a preserved feed source intended for consumption during periods when fresh pasture is unavailable, such as winter or drought. Its classification as a crop is based on the fact that the forage plants are specifically cultivated, managed, and harvested for their economic value as a livestock feed.

The critical distinction between hay and other forages lies in the moisture content and preservation method. Fresh pasture is high-moisture forage consumed directly by grazing animals. Silage is chopped forage that is fermented and stored in an airtight environment at a high moisture level, typically between 40% and 60%. Hay is a dry roughage product that must be cured to a low moisture content, generally between 12% and 20%, to prevent spoilage.

The Agricultural Cycle of Hay Production

The creation of dry hay involves a precise, multi-stage agricultural cycle focused on rapid moisture reduction and nutrient preservation. The cycle begins with mowing or cutting, which must be timed to coincide with the forage plant’s peak vegetative stage, such as before the alfalfa plant begins to flower. Farmers often use mower-conditioners, which cut the forage and simultaneously crimp or crush the plant stems to accelerate the drying rate.

Following the initial cut, the curing phase is the most sensitive period. This is accomplished through the use of a tedder, a machine that gently fluffs and spreads the cut material. This action exposes more of the plant surface area to the sun and air, which is essential to quickly reduce the moisture content from the initial 80% or 90% down to the required 15% to 20% for safe storage. This process typically requires several consecutive days of dry, sunny weather to complete without rain damage.

The next step is raking, where the partially dried forage is swept into long, continuous rows known as windrows. Raking turns the hay one last time for final drying and gathers the material into a manageable line. The final step is baling, where a baler compresses the cured hay into dense, transportable units, ready for storage and eventual use as feed.

Major Types of Hay and Their Uses

The two broad categories of hay are grass hay and legume hay, each offering a distinct nutritional profile suited for different livestock needs. Legume hays, which include alfalfa and various clovers, are known for their high concentration of protein, calcium, and energy. Alfalfa hay, for example, can have a crude protein level ranging from 14% to 26% and is typically reserved for animals with high nutritional demands, such as lactating dairy cows, young growing stock, and performance horses.

Grass hays, such as timothy, orchardgrass, and fescue, generally contain lower levels of protein and energy but are richer in fiber. Timothy hay is a common choice for horses, as its balanced fiber content supports digestive health. This type of forage is also suitable for mature animals or those prone to easy weight gain. Farmers often select a mixed hay, which combines grass and legume species, to achieve a nutritional balance tailored to the specific requirements of their herd.
